House leveling services involve adjusting and stabilizing a building's foundation to correct uneven or settling floors, cracks, and structural issues. This process typically includes inspecting the foundation, identifying areas of subsidence or movement, and using specialized equipment to lift and reinforce the structure. Projects can range from addressing minor unevenness to major foundation repairs for homes experiencing significant shifting, ensuring the property remains safe and structurally sound.

Property owners often seek house leveling to prevent further damage, improve safety, and restore the property's value. Before requesting this service, it is helpful to understand the signs of foundation problems, such as cracked walls, sticking doors, or uneven floors, and to learn about the scope of work needed for their specific situation. Clarifying expectations about the process and potential outcomes can assist in making informed decisions about foundation stabilization and repair.

Common House Leveling Jobs

Foundation leveling - correcting uneven or sinking foundations to ensure structural stability.

Slab stabilization - addressing cracks or shifts in concrete slabs to prevent further damage.

Pier and beam adjustment - realigning and supporting homes built on pier and beam foundations.

Basement leveling - fixing uneven floors and walls caused by shifting or settling soil.

Concrete slab raising - lifting sunken or cracked concrete slabs to restore level surfaces.

Structural repair services - reinforcing and stabilizing foundations to maintain long-term integrity.

House Leveling Questions

What is house leveling? House leveling is the process of correcting uneven or sinking foundations to restore stability and proper alignment of a building.

When is house leveling needed? House leveling may be necessary if there are noticeable cracks, uneven floors, or doors and windows that don’t close properly.

What methods are used for house leveling? Common methods include pier and beam adjustments, slab jacking, or underpinning to lift and stabilize the foundation.

How can property owners prepare for house leveling? Property owners should ensure clear access to the foundation area and address any existing drainage or landscaping issues beforehand.
